The Major Advantages of Choosing an Automatic Vehicle

Automatic vehicles are gaining traction among new drivers, and for good reason. They offer numerous advantages that can significantly enhance the learning experience. Let’s delve deeper into these benefits:

Learning to drive in a busy environment demands your full attention. Automatic cars simplify the entire learning process by removing the need for manual gear selection, allowing you to focus on becoming a safe and confident driver. Here are some key advantages:

  • Zero Clutch Control Stress: You will never have to worry about stalling your car at busy roundabouts or traffic lights.
  • Faster Progress: Without the need to master gears, most learners require fewer lesson hours to become fully test-ready.
  • Better Focus on Road Safety: You can dedicate 100% of your concentration to hazard perception, speed limits, and navigation.

  • Is an Automatic License Right for You?

    Furthermore, as the technology in the automotive sector advances, automatic vehicles are becoming more affordable and accessible. Many car manufacturers are prioritizing the production of automatic and electric vehicles, which could mean that by choosing an automatic license, you are future-proofing your driving capabilities. Additionally, automatic driving lessons often incorporate modern teaching techniques and technologies that enhance the learning experience, providing feedback that can help you improve more effectively.

    If you want a stress-free experience and wish to pass your practical test quickly, an automatic driving instructor can help you achieve independence faster. While an automatic license limits you to driving automatic vehicles, the automotive market is moving rapidly toward electric and automatic cars, making this a highly forward-thinking and practical choice. Many new drivers find that the convenience of automatic cars aligns with their lifestyle, particularly in busy urban environments where ease of driving is paramount.
